Get Up and Grow!

“Do you want my one-word secret of happiness? It’s growth — mental, financial, you name it.”
(Harold Geneen)

Positive psychology has been a booming business lately. Scores of new “paths to happiness” have filled our bookshelves and newsfeeds. The ones worth examining, however, are usually not the most popular.

Why? Because just like the most beautiful mountain vistas can only be found after the most difficult hikes, the truest paths to happiness are the ones that often take the most patience, diligence, and endurance.

We can argue about whether this is fair, but let’s not argue whether this is true. When we are growing, when we are learning, when we are stretching ourselves to do and say and be better, we are happier people.
